Jessica’s expectations were modest when she came to CatholicMatch. After going through the pain of her first marriage ending, she wasn’t in a rush to find someone. “My daughters wanted me to find a good man,” she said, recalling her initial motivation.
The early returns on CatholicMatch were as modest as Jessica’s original expectations. The first dates the 35-year-old health care worker from San Antonio went on weren’t prepared to date a woman with kids. “I was ready to end my one month trial when I responded to one last man that sounded interesting.”
Gordon was that man, a 39-year-old electrical engineer who also lived in the San Antonio area. He’d spent seven years serving his country in the Navy, had never been married and as Jessica would soon find out, he was very open to embracing her daughters as his own.
“He seemed too good to be true,” Jessica said. “I didn’t feel like typing notes back and forth forever, so I just said ‘You sound interesting, call me if you want to get to know me better.’” Her phone indeed rang.
